Advanced Air Intake Systems

A major improvement for enhancing vehicle performance lies in the implementation of performance air intake systems. These systems are designed to optimize airflow into the engine, allowing for enhanced combustion efficiency. By reducing intake restrictions, performance air intakes increase horsepower and torque, resulting in a more responsive throttle and superior acceleration.

Moreover, they often feature high-flow filters that optimize filtration and lifespan, ensuring cleaner air flows into the engine. Installation is typically straightforward, making it accessible for many enthusiasts. Additionally, some systems offer a characteristic noise that enhances the driving experience. Overall, performance air intake systems serve as a fundamental modification for those seeking to elevate their vehicle's strength and performance.

High-Quality Exhaust Options

By optimizing airflow with performance air intake systems, upgrading to high-performance exhaust options can improve engine output further. High-performance exhaust units are constructed to minimize resistance, permitting more effective discharge of exhaust gases. This enhanced circulation can yield significant gains in horsepower and torque.

Options like performance exhausts and header systems deliver different advantages, with cat-back systems refitting the exhaust from the catalytic converter to the rear, while headers optimize the manifold's efficiency. Additionally, using lightweight materials such as stainless steel or titanium can minimize overall vehicle weight, promoting better vehicle performance.

Ultimately, opting for superior exhaust systems not only optimizes engine efficiency but also amplifies the vehicle's sound, delivering a more thrilling driving experience.

Improving Handling With Undercarriage Modifications

Enhanced engine performance often causes enthusiasts to reflect on other important aspects of their vehicle's dynamics, such as handling. Upgrading suspension components is essential for improving a car's performance, making certain that it can maneuver through corners and bumps with precision. Enhanced struts and shocks are created to improve stability, reduce body roll, and elevate overall ride quality.

Performance adjustable suspensions can offer flexible height and damping settings, allowing drivers to modify their setup according to driving style and conditions. Additionally, sway bars help to reduce lateral movement during turns, resulting in increased cornering grip.

Upgrading to performance bushings can markedly improve quick response, cutting flex in the suspension system. These modifications not only strengthen handling but also contribute to a more thrilling driving experience. For those striving to realize their vehicle's potential, investing in quality suspension modifications is a vital step toward achieving superior handling and overall performance.

Tire Designations Interpreted

What impact can the right tires make in a vehicle's performance? The choice of tire type is essential in maneuvering, traction, and the overall driving experience. All-season tires provide versatility for various weather conditions, while summer tires shine in warm and dry climates, offering improved grip and cornering capabilities. For off-road lovers, mud-terrain tires come with aggressive treads designed to master tough terrains. On the other hand, performance tires maximize speed and responsiveness, suiting racing or spirited driving. Each type fulfills particular needs, influencing acceleration, braking, and stability. In the end, selecting the right tires not only enhances performance but also increases safety, enabling drivers to manage various conditions with confidence and efficiency.

Wheel Material Benefits

While the choice of wheel material may seem secondary to tire choice, it significantly affects a vehicle's performance and performance. Aluminum wheels, recognized for their light weight, enhance acceleration and braking effectiveness, improving overall responsiveness. Their ability to release thermal energy also aids in maintaining optimal tire performance during high-speed driving. In contrast, steel wheels, while heavier and less expensive, offer durability and resistance to damage, making them appropriate for daily driving and rough conditions. Carbon fiber wheels represent a high-end choice, offering remarkable weight-to-strength proportions that improve air resistance and turning stability. Ultimately, selecting the appropriate wheel material allows drivers to customize their vehicle's performance traits, balancing speed, comfort, and durability based on individual driving needs.
